Suspected kidnappers demand N30m ransom on kogi traditional ruler, Azeez’s fate unknown

By Correspondent in Okene

Suspected kidnappers who abducted a first class traditional ruler in kogi state have demanded N30 million for the royal father to regain freedom.

A source, who is also an indigene of Egayin, disclosed this on Wednesday while in a telephone dialogue with Journalists.

He recalled that the kidnappers called the family of the Adogu by 1 p.m on Wednesday and demanded for ransom of 30 million naira to enable him regain his freedom.

The Source, however, could not say if the family of the traditional were able to raise the amount demanded by the suspects.

Our Correspondent reports that the latest development came barely 24 hours after the Managing Director of Azeco Pharmacy, Okene, Abdulazeez Obajimoh was Kidnapped in the heart of Okene, the headquarters of Okene Area of the state at about 3 p.m.

Sources in Okene said the abduction of Obajimoh resulted in gunshots from the suspects resulting in the killing of one Habeeb Anda and injured two others before the kidnappers escaped to the thin air with their victim, unchallenged.

Feelers from the family of Obajimoh indicates that the alleged Kidnappers have not called on his family to demand for ransom.

Confirming the Kidnapping of the traditional ruler, the Police Public Relation Officer(PPRO) for the Police Command in Kogi State,DSP. William Aya, said the police command had deployed special squad to trail the abductors.

He called on the general public to assist the police with useful information to enable security agencies rescue the royal father.
